Jack Littlewood

Jack is a drummer and percussionist originally from Harrogate, now based in Newcastle. He has been playing drums since the age of 5, and achieved Grade 8 drums at 13. He has recently graduated with a 1st in Music from Newcastle University. 

He has extensive experience across all genres of music, from pit bands to orchestras, punk bands to big bands. He achieved a lot at a young age in brass banding, becoming the principal percussionist in the National Youth Brass Band of Great Britain, and being named in the 4barsrest Global Band of the Year at 18. 

In recent years, Jack has had the opportunity to perform in many of the UK’s most prestigious venues, such as the Royal Albert Hall in London, First Direct Arena in Leeds, Usher Hall in Edinburgh, and The Glasshouse in Gateshead. 

Over the course of the last three years spent in Newcastle, Jack has had extensive performance experience, largely based in jazz, but now plays across a plethora of genres and ensembles. This includes leading his own jazz trio, Look Left, as well as playing with alt-rock band Pørters, neo-soul singer Georgia May, jazz guitarist Jacob Egglestone, and being a member of street drumming group Spark! 

Jack teaches Drums at our North Shields school.
